The mainstem Nehalem doesn’t have any hatchery steelhead releases, but there are wild steelhead available for catch-and-release fishing throughout the basin. The Nehalem is already off color and is predicted to go up again Wednesday night and Thursday. It may not back into shape for a while. Avoiding long fights and handling will reduce stress on released fish.
